Renting vehicles for adventure across California combines convenience with practical access. Platforms offer dynamic pricing, ultra-fast booking, and vehicle matching based on ride type, route needs, and destination. Many services prioritize flexible terms—from city-to-coast commutes to weekend off-roading—making spontaneous trips feasible without travel peaks priced out. With carefully located pickup points near popular tourist corridors, scenic byways, and national parks, rentals optimize both time and terrain access. This balance of flexibility, affordability, and strategic availability transforms the idea of “road adventure” from fantasy into everyday reality—proven through growing user satisfaction and repeat bookings.

One myth: All ride rentals require long contracts. Most platforms offer short-term, pay-per-use models with flexible start/end times and easy cancellations. Another confusion: Only luxury vehicles are available. In reality, a broad range—from compact cars to premium SUVs—ensures options match purpose. Some assume rentals are complicated—yet user-friendly apps and in-person support make the process intuitive even for first-time renters. Clarity on these details builds confidence and realism around open-road adventure.
